For all those who have a pair of the Air Max 1G, I was curious on their level of water defense. The details say they are "water-repellent" and not "waterproof" like other models. I'm thinking the leather material might be better than the material in my TW15s. I played at 6am this morning and my feet were soaked by the third hole from the standard morning dew and sprinklers.

They’re ok. If you’re walking on wet ground then you won’t have any issues, but I’ve found that the problem comes when you walk through long grass (ie longer than shin high) as the water goes through the laces/tongue part of the shoe.

 

That said, even in really wet conditions, the grip remains brilliant.

I just get the eraser wet and off I go. Super easy. For my shoelaces I put them in the washing machine, but never the dryer.

 

Toothbrush and dishwashing soap is old stuff, don't bother.

The spray repellant doesn't work / makes your shoes hard as a rock.

 

I get MrClean 8 pack from Amazon. Check slickdeals for a deal. Usually can score the good erasers with the scrubber in the middle (4 pack) for $3 bucks when it comes up. But I usually go for the regular 8 pack of Mr Clean.

 

Ive tried the Walmart / Target brand and hate them. They dont have enough "clean" in them and require a lot more scrubbing, thus never last more than 1 pair.

 

As for golf, when I am done playing I wipe down my pair with my wet towel that I use to clean my clubs. Rinse the towel off after the round, but before you clean the shoes. You won't get all the dirt off, but it'll get the hard stuff off since its fresh. Get home and a simple wipe down with Mr Clean = good as new.
